don't worry, I'm not batting for the other team - due to the endless lack of wind, and the high chance that january will be just as bad i couldn't tolerate doing nothing.
Although most on this forum don't want to hear this, it's worth giving it a try just for fun because it is really very easy, much easier than it looks (so long as there's wind to keep the kite in the bloody air) and nothing like learning to windsurf (no matter what the shops tell you

). I've had about 4 hours on the kite with dan and chairman, and today i've been body dragging about, can re-launch ok, and i feel ready to ride the board. Dans already on the board going back and forth. You will be shocked at how quickly you'll get to the point that i'm at. the hardest part so far was the initial 20 minute of crapping yer pants because you not sure what the kite's going to do

, but after that it's gravy so long as you do it safely of course. i'm not sure i'd go out in 25+ knots with it though
